Post Travel Blues

Post-vacation-syndrome - also called post-travel blues or post-holiday depression - is when one experiences feelings of depression and/or anxiety after a vacation. It can also manifest as irritability, listlessness, difficulty concentrating, and sleep issues, i.e., insomnia or sleeping too much.

Post-vacation blues (Canada and US), post-holiday blues (UK, Ireland and some Commonwealth countries) or post-travel depression ( PTD) is a type of mood that persons returning home from a long trip (usually a vacation) may experience. [1] Background

7 tips to get over the postvacation blues and go back to the routine

Buy experiences, not souvenirs. One key way to make the positive effects of a vacation last after you return home, according to the University of Chicago postdoctoral research fellow Amit Kumar and Cornell professor Thomas Gilovich, both psychologists, is to focus on making experiential "purchases" while on vacation, rather than shopping for.
